Are you, or do you know, someone that's going to college for the first time? For many people the first year of college can be a struggle and will make or break many students. Learning the ropes by yourself can be tough, but with the guidance of College Freshman Survival 101 it can be much easier. Things like knowing where your classes are, learning to network with others, and simply being able to separate work and play are just a few of the many imperative skills that every college student needs. This book will explain how to acquire these skills and why they're important in a way that's easy to understand. College Freshman Survival 101 was based on personal experiences from both the author himself and other college students. College Freshman Survival 101 is a short and simple guide about how to handle yourself for students who are either a freshman in college or will be attending college for the first time at some point. However, there are still tips in this book that can be used by anybody in school in many different aspects of their school life. Hopefully this guide will answer all of your college related questions and make your college experience as fun as possible!
